Durability
While Clairol promises up to 8 weeks of color, real-world conditions might see some fading around the 6-week mark, especially with frequent washing. However, the color fades evenly, which means no awkward patchiness. If you want to stretch out the time between applications, using color-safe shampoo and conditioner can help maintain the vibrancy.

Is Clairol Hair Dye safe for sensitive scalps?
Yes, the ammonia-free formula is gentler on sensitive scalps compared to traditional dyes.
How long does the color last?
The color typically lasts up to 8 weeks, but this can vary depending on hair type and washing frequency.
